出 处:《眼科新进展》2006年第10期737-739,共3页Recent Advances in Ophthalmology
摘 要:目的评价重组腺伴随病毒载体介导的绿色荧光蛋白基因(recombinant adeno-associated virus-mediated green fluorescence protein,rAAV-GFP)对体外培养的鼠视网膜神经节细胞(retinal ganglion cells ,RGCs)的转染效率和安全性。方法取出生24 h内的SD乳鼠的视网膜神经上皮层,行视网膜神经细胞的体外混合培养;培养2 d后,按转染倍数(multiple oninfection,MOI)为10、102、103、104、105对细胞进行转染;5 d后行流式细胞仪检测细胞表达绿荧光的比率,并应用PE-Thy1 .1抗体标记RGCs ,评价不同MOI的rAAV-GFP对RGCs的转染效率。应用MTT比色方法检测各组细胞的生长活性。结果MOI为10、102、103、104、105时,对混合培养的全体细胞的转染效率分别为6·4 %、15.6 %、20.2 %、45.1 %和65.8 %,其中对RGCs的转染效率分别为11.7 %、22.5 %、27.7 %、52.0 %和75.3 %;rAAV-GFP转染RGCs后,细胞生长状态正常;MTT比色结果显示,各转染细胞和未转染细胞的光吸收值无显著性差异(P>0 .05)。结论 rAAV作为体外培养的SD乳鼠RGCs转染的载体是安全可行的,且对细胞生长无明显影响。Objective To evaluate the efficiency and safety of transfecting green fluorescence protein gene mediated by recombinant adeno-associated virus(rAAV-GFP) to retinal ganglion cells (RGCs) of rats. Methods The retina of neonatal Sprague-Dawley rats ( postnatal within 24 hours) was dissected into cells suspension with trypsin digestion ,and the cells suspension were cultured without purification. Two days later, the cells were transfected by rAAVGFP by adding virus suspension into the cell culture medium according to various multiples on infection (MOI) ( MOI =10、10^2、10^3、10^4、10^5 ). The transfecting efficiency of rAAV-GFP to RGCs was evaluated by flow cytometer 5 days after the transfection. MTT was added to each well, then the survival cells were evaluated by the optical density (OD) values with ELISA-reader. Results When MOI was 10、10^2、10^3、10^4、and 10^5, the transducting efficiency of rAAV-GFP to the total cells was 6.4%, 15.6%,20.2%, 45. 1%and 65.8% respectively; And the transducting efficiency of rAAV-GFP to RGCs was 11.7 %, 22.5 %,27.7 %, 52.0 % and 75.3% respectively. MTT colortmetric assay showed that the Or) values of tmnsfected cells with various MOI and untransfected cells had no statistical difference (P〉0.05).Conclusion rAAV as the transfecting vector has a satisfying safety for RGCs of rats in vitro and has no inhibitory effect to the RGCs.
